Ø Dealing with conversion of DC plans (401K, Retirement plans, PSP) for ECM and Mid plans.
Ø Working with the prior plan trustee & record keeper which includes coordinating the transfer of plan assets as well as all of the other data elements associated with the plan's conversion.
Ø In managing the asset transfer process, we are responsible for directing the transactions on Fidelity Participant Recordkeeping System (FPRS).
Ø Reconciling the assets received with the corresponding participant balances. This includes researching issues with the prior trustee, prior record keeper and client so the issues are resolved timely.
